Silicon- and Tin-Containing Open-Chain and Eight-Membered-Ring Compounds as Bicentric Lewis Acids toward Anions

Herein, we report the syntheses of silicon‐ and tin‐containing open‐chain and eight‐membered‐ring compounds Me2Si(CH2SnMe2X)2 (2, X=Me; 3, X=Cl; 4, X=F), CH2(SnMe2CH2I)2 (7), CH2(SnMe2CH2Cl)2 (8), cyclo‐Me2Sn(CH2SnMe2CH2)2SiMe2 (6), cyclo‐(Me2SnCH2)4 (9), cyclo‐Me(2−n)XnSn(CH2SiMe2CH2)2SnXnMe(2−n) (5, n=0; 10, n=1, X=Cl; 11, n=1, X=F; 12, n=2, X=Cl), and the chloride and fluoride complexes NEt4[cyclo‐
